Residential Roof Replacement in Providence, RI
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new roofing system to protect a home from weather elements. This service typically covers projects where the current roof is damaged, aged, or no longer provides adequate protection. Homeowners often request roof replacements due to persistent leaks, extensive wear, or the need to upgrade to more durable materials.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the size and shape of their roof, the type of roofing materials they prefer, and any local building codes or regulations that may influence the project.
Understanding the scope of a roof replacement is essential for homeowners planning to undertake the project. This includes evaluating the condition of the existing roof, identifying any underlying issues such as rotting or structural damage, and choosing appropriate materials that match the home's style and performance needs. Property owners should also be aware of the potential impact on property access and the importance of proper installation to ensure the longevity and performance of the new roof. Residential Roof Replacement Questions
What signs indicate a ro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, or extensive wear can suggest a roof requires replacement.
What types of roofing materials are commonly used for replacements? Asphalt shingles, metal, and architectural shingles are popular choices for residential roof replacements.
How does a roof replacement improve property value? A new roof enhances curb appeal and can increase the overall value of the home or property.
What should property owners consider before scheduling a roof replacement? It's important to assess the roof's condition, choose suitable materials, and plan for any necessary permits or inspections.
